About Course

The most sophisticated recognition platform and the most generous rewards budget will underperform if the managers responsible for delivering recognition lack the skills to do it well. Managers are the single most influential factor in whether recognition lands as meaningful or misses entirely — yet most organizations invest far more in program design than in managers’ capabilities. This micro course explores why manager skill is the linchpin of any effective R&R strategy and provides a practical framework for developing managers who recognize consistently, meaningfully, and with measurable impact.
